Output 21befc6addc81533cb988e5b17e6ad179ebbeb0c971c58ed385192e7c97ba97f:1

value
14592415
script pubkey
OP_0 OP_PUSHBYTES_20 09d3ef58a0d53d827e9f8ebac158300edc4ec36b
address
bc1qp8f77k9q657cyl5l36avzkpspmwyasmtafedsj
transaction
21befc6addc81533cb988e5b17e6ad179ebbeb0c971c58ed385192e7c97ba97f
spent
true